Insérer une page php d'un autre site

Eléphant du PHP | 271 Messages

08 nov. 2008, 16:02

Bonjour,

je souhaite insérer une page php située chez un autre hébergeur dans un site qui lui est hébergé chez wanadoo. Wanadoo ne supportant que le html je pensai faire ça. Bien sur ça ne fonctionne pas.

Code : Tout sélectionner

<file src="http://www.mapage.php" />
Est ce que cela est possible et si oui comment ? Je suppose que c'est à peu près comme je l'ai écrit.

Merci d'avance de l'aide
Patience et obstination sont des qualités !

Administrateur PHPfrance
Administrateur PHPfrance | 11457 Messages

08 nov. 2008, 17:15

Si tu peux accéder à cette page via un lien, rien de plus simple que :
<a href="http://www.mapage.php">La suite (en PHP)</a>
Garanti 100% HTML ! ;)

Mammouth du PHP | 2937 Messages

08 nov. 2008, 17:34

Si tu tiens vraiment à afficher ta page PHP sur ta page perso, tu peux tenter de recourir à l'élément iframe (auquel cas il faudra utiliser un doctype HTML 4.01 ou XHTML 1.0 Transitional).

Code : Tout sélectionner

<iframe src="http://exemple.com/mapage.php" width="800" height="600" scrolling="auto" frameborder="0"> Pour les navigateurs ne supportant pas l'élément <code>iframe</code> ou l'ayant désactivé, fournir un <a href="http://exemple.com/mapage.php">lien direct vers la page en question</a>, afin de garantir l'accessibilité à tous, y compris aux moteurs de recherche. </iframe>
Modifié en dernier par Victor BRITO le 08 nov. 2008, 17:35, modifié 1 fois.

Eléphant du PHP | 271 Messages

08 nov. 2008, 17:34

merci mais ce n'est pas ça que je souhaite faire.
La page s'affiche sur le site x chez l'hébergeur x et je souhaite qu'elle s'affiche aussi sur le site y chez l'hébergeur y.

Donc un lien ne me convient pas forcément.
Patience et obstination sont des qualités !

Mammouth du PHP | 2937 Messages

08 nov. 2008, 17:39

merci mais ce n'est pas ça que je souhaite faire.
La page s'affiche sur le site x chez l'hébergeur x et je souhaite qu'elle s'affiche aussi sur le site y chez l'hébergeur y.

Donc un lien ne me convient pas forcément.
Dans ce cas, vu que l'hébergeur Y n'accepte pas le PHP, tu ne pourras pas faire grand'chose, malheureusement, si ce n'est changer d'hébergeur.

Eléphant du PHP | 271 Messages

08 nov. 2008, 17:43

Merci victor brito pour la solution. Je ne connaissais pas la balise <i frame>. J'ai testé sous ie5.5, ie6 et + ainsi de firefox et ça fonctionne. Quels sont les navigateurs si tu les connais que ne supporte pas cette balise ?
Patience et obstination sont des qualités !

Mammouth du PHP | 2937 Messages

08 nov. 2008, 17:49

Quels sont les navigateurs si tu les connais que ne supporte pas cette balise ?
De mémoire, je n'en connais pas. S'il y en a, il s'agit plus de navigateurs textuels éventuellement (de type Lynx) et de certaines aides techniques, comme les lecteurs d'écran (utilisés par les aveugles, notamment).

Eléphant du PHP | 271 Messages

08 nov. 2008, 17:56

Je te remercie pour ton aide précieuse. Les personnes qui utiliseront le site sont des personnes qui utilisent principalement les navigateurs les plus connus.

Merci encore
Patience et obstination sont des qualités !

Mammouth du PHP | 2937 Messages

08 nov. 2008, 18:01

Les personnes qui utiliseront le site sont des personnes qui utilisent principalement les navigateurs les plus connus.
Certes ; mais, il n'est jamais exclu qu'on tombe sur un utilisateur d'un navigateur « exotique ». ;)

ViPHP
ViPHP | 4674 Messages

09 nov. 2008, 02:53

Hey :),
J'ai testé sous ie5.5, ie6 et + ainsi de firefox et ça fonctionne.
T'as pas pensé à essayer sur IE 3 et Netscape 4 aussi ? Non parce que c'est peut-être encore utilisé …
Je pense que tu peux abandonner les tests sur IE 5.x hein :). Concentre toi plutôt sur Opera, Firefox, Safari et IE. Pour les versions, tous les utilisateurs d'Opera, Firefox et Safari sont à jour. Pour les utilisateurs d'IE, tu peux tester IE 6, 7 et la bêta 8. Pas besoin de tester autre chose. Les gens qui prennent des navigateurs moins populaires savent ce qu'ils font, ils sont censés s'y connaître.
«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»

Hoa : http://hoa-project.net (sur @hoaproject).